Prep Time: 10 Minutes Cook Time: 10 Minutes |
Ready In: 20 Minutes Servings: 2 |
|
Recommended on a quilting list. This is a really fun and different way to have chicken. Ingredients:
2 boneless skinless chicken breast halves |
2 slices pineapple |
2 slices oranges |
4 slices tangerines (wedges) |
1 cup orange juice |
2 tablespoons pineapple juice |
2 tablespoons olive oil |
1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ese |
2 tablespoons flour |
2 -4 slices hawaiian bread |
Directions:
1. Add olive oil to skillet on medium-high heat. 2. Brown chicken breasts on both sides- approximately 1-2 minutes per side. 3. Reduce heat to low and cook chicken until it is done (approx. 3 minutes). 4. After you cook the first side, turn and top each breast with a pineapple ring and a orange slice and two tangerine wedges. 5. Top generously with the mozzarella. 6. Cook for an additional 3 minutes. 7. In the meantime, toast the bread until golden brown. 8. Arrange the toast on two plates. 9. When the chicken is done, take the chicken breasts out of the skillet and arrange on the toast. 10. Add the orange juice and pineapple juice to the skillet. 11. Increase heat to medium-high and bring liquid to a boil. 12. Thicken sauce with flour, whisking until it is smooth but not watery. 13. Top the chickenbreasts wtih a generous amount of sauce and enjoy! 14. Note: This recipe is easy to increase for more people. |
